If your company's stock is performing well and you believe it will continue to appreciate, holding onto your RSUs may be a wise choice. Conversely, if you anticipate a downturn in the stock price, selling your RSUs upon vesting may be more prudent.
Restricted Stock Units cannot be sold or transferred while they are subject to forfeiture. This means that the employee cannot sell or transfer the units until they are vested.
Restricted stock refers to an award of stock to a person that is subject to conditions that must be met before the stockholder can exercise the right to transfer or sell the stock. It is commonly issued to corporate officers such as directors and senior executives.
The company offers restricted shares to the company executives, whereas common stock to the general public. It is easier to transfer and sell common stocks than restricted stocks. Can I sell my restricted stock? You can sell your restricted stock after the vesting period is over.
